Output dd37e12146831a3abed261a6a6ab3db55d16bfa0105c5ec9f30b85323ba8dab5:85

value
24940
script pubkey
OP_0 OP_PUSHBYTES_20 8754fadf9b107b054bb529ad805247934d3a81ef
address
bc1qsa204humzpas2ja49xkcq5j8jdxn4q00flvc76
transaction
dd37e12146831a3abed261a6a6ab3db55d16bfa0105c5ec9f30b85323ba8dab5